Diesel Engine

An internal combustion engine in which heat produced by the compression of air in the cylinder is used to ignite the fuel.

Alpha

A coefficient representing the level of significance in hypothesis testing, often set at 0.05 or 5%, indicating the probability of rejecting a true null hypothesis.
